WOW! What a main character! Michele "Micky" Knight is "old school", she drinks too much, has her life together but not really and she sort of knows what she wants. You will either enjoy her character as the story unfolds or you will not. What I like is her persistence, care for others and not stopping until the job is complete. It took quite awhile, maybe a little over halfway through, to start liking this book. The characters weren't doing it for me and were typical lesbian fiction cliches. The story meandered a bit and it felt like this could easily have been 50-75 pages shorter and tighter. However, at the end of the day, I did want to see how the story ended and felt the last few chapters were quite good. ...more

First book of Mickey Knight series. Detective Michelle Knight (Mickey to her friends) set in NOLA, written in the style of Sam Spade and Mike Hammer with a lesbian twist. Money, drugs, dangers and of course the beautiful woman in danger.
